The Cursillo Movement was born in Spain in the 1940's, it came to the United States in 1957, and to the Kansas City-St. Joseph Diocese in 1962. Cursillo is not a substitute for your parish church. The Cursillo Movement came to birth in the movements of renewal that preceded the second Vatican Council. Most organized efforts of Catholic laity taking part in the work of the Church were part of Catholic Action (which was supported and directed by the hierarchy).

The founders, dedicated to helping Catholics get to know Christ better, wanted to give laypeople a renewed spirituality and a clearer understanding of how Christ can work through them. 1) Expand his/her prayer life through an individual program of daily spiritual exercise; 2) Initiate an ongoing program of spiritual study; 3) Evangelize as a natural attribute of being Christ-like in our daily activities. Send an email under the "Contact" tab. The Cursillo Movement came to birth from the renewal of faith inspired by Vatican II. The liturgical movement, the scriptural renewal, Catholic Action and other movements of the lay apostolate had begun years before the Council. Cursillo begins with a 3-Day Weekend of joyful sharing and living out what is fundamental to being a Christian – a very adult Catholic catechesis if you will. Quoting an article by historian Robert Wood: "In the old days, the housewife's work week was ordered by a strict schedule: Monday, washday; Tuesday, ironing; Wednesday, mending; Thursday, market; Friday, baking; Saturday, cleaning; Sunday, church.
